Achieving ISO/IEC 20000 : Keeping the service going (BIP 0036)

Price: €59.95


Some aspects of Service Management are more important in keeping the service running every day, month by month, by avoiding anythiug going wrong, planning for how the impact of a disaster will be avoided and accepting that when something does fail, it is fixed in the best possible time. This book covers these processes : Service Continuity and Availability Managaement & Incident and Problem Management. It explains and compares the role of theses processes, how they will interface with each other and gives examples and practical hints that will help the service provider achieve ISO/IEC 20000.
